HMAS Pirie Boarded by Indonesian Navy

14 May 2010

HMAS Pirie

For the first time in Navy’s history, a ship has been boarded by members of the Indonesian Navy after it was suspected of containing illegally caught fish.

According to the Commanding Officer ASSAIL SIX Lieutenant Commander Sean Logan embarked HMAS Pirie, his ship was forced to stop after two rounds from KRI Untung Suropati landed fifty metres starboard quarter.

“I thought we would get away with it. I had no idea Australia was passing intelligence to the Indonesians about our activities, resulting in the interception of my ship,” said LCDR Logan.

After stopping, a boarding party from KRI Untung Suropati was despatched, quickly taking control of HMAS Pirie, detaining the crew and confiscating the cargo.

This incident was of course a simulation. As part of Exercise CASSOWARY 10, HMAS Pirie was used to help create a realistic scenario for the Indonesian Navy to practice their boarding party skills.

With the apprehension successfully completed, members of HMAS Pirie then demonstrated their skills by boarding KRI Kerapu, also masquerading as a foreign fishing vessel.

“The purpose of this exercise was for the Indonesian and Australian navies to observe each other’s boarding operations, enabling us to fine tune our approach and improve existing methods,” said LCDR Logan.

LCDR Logan said that the importance in practising boarding parties and sharing lessons learnt with the Indonesians cannot be underestimated.

“Although boarding operations are common for the RAN and TNI-AL, they are not routine as each boat we board is unique and may require a different approach,” said LCDR Logan.

“This is the first time I have participated in joint maritime operations with the Indonesian Navy and CASSOWARY 10 has certainly exceeded my expectations. ASSAIL SIX and I have learnt a lot which we will now start to put into practice,” LCDR Logan stated.
